Texas Super Lawyers, a compilation of the most highly regarded lawyers in the state, has once again selected three lawyers from Dallas’ Rose•Walker, L.L.P. for inclusion on its 2010 list.

This year marks the sixth consecutive appearance in Texas Super Lawyers by firm co-founder Marty Rose, the third time for partner Don Swaim, and the second time for partner Michael Richardson. Only 5 percent of the approximately 70,000 Texas lawyers make the Super Lawyers list, which is compiled after a statewide survey, peer nominations and an extensive review by Super Lawyers staff.

The list will be published in the October issue of Texas Monthly and in Texas Super Lawyers magazine, a service of Thomson Reuters, Legal Division.

“Over the years, we have worked hard to build a top-quality law firm that provides exceptional legal services,” Mr. Rose says. “Earning our colleagues’ recognition is an honor and, we believe, a reflection of the excellent work all of the lawyers at
Rose• Walker do each and every day.”

Mr. Rose’s trial career spans more than 36 years and includes scores of cases tried in federal and state courts across the country involving high-risk commercial disputes, intellectual property litigation, personal injury claims and wrongful death cases. His work has been highlighted in respected business and legal publications in Texas and nationwide. Both he and Mr. Richardson were named to the Texas Super Lawyers list based on their work in business litigation.

Mr. Richardson has tried dozens of cases in federal and state courts in Texas and several other states. He represents plaintiffs and defendants in personal injury and wrongful death claims involving transportation accidents, airplane crashes and product liability claims, as well as in commercial disputes and intellectual property litigation.

Mr. Swaim’s extensive trial experience includes representing both plaintiffs and defendants in aviation litigation, products liability, premises liability and personal injury claims. He was selected to Texas Super Lawyers based on his expertise in aviation law.
